There is strong evidence linking Kaposi's sarcoma with an increased risk of developing a second primary malignancy. This risk of a second malignancy appears to depend in part on the clinical setting in which Kaposi's sarcoma develops. This paper examines these risks by relating them to specific subsets of Kaposi's sarcoma and to specific types of second malignancies.
